Users initiate cancellation via a POST request to a specified URL, providing the operation's name. The server attempts cancellation, potentially returning `UNIMPLEMENTED`. Clients check the operation's status using `GetOperation`. Successful cancellation results in an operation with an error code `1` (`CANCELLED`), and the operation isn't deleted. The request body is empty, and the response, if successful, is also empty. Specific OAuth scopes are required.\n"]]
